Our only regret is that we didn't come to Dough Boys on our first day! This was easily the best meal we had during our 3 days in Hilton Head. The cheesy bread was cheesy and sleezy, the meatballs melted in our mouths, the chopped Caesar salad was surprisingly perfect, and the White Pizza with Italian sausage and ricotta was ooey and gooey. We're honestly sad this was our last meal because if we'd found this place sooner, we would've been here for breakfast, brunch, lunch, dinner, snacks, and a midnight snack too! If you're in Hilton Head, do yourself a favor and eat here. We can't wait to come back!

Never again. We've ordered from Dough Boys every year for the past 5 years on our trips to HHI but our most recent experience will be our last. The primary issue is service, or lack thereof. We had a similar issue last year but gave them the benefit of the doubt. We won't make that mistake again. I placed a delivery order at 5 PM for 2 pizzas and mozzarella sticks. At 6:45, with no delivery made and the website simply showing "preparing", we attempted to call. At automated answer told us to remain on the line to be helped by the next person available. At 7:15PM, after 30 minutes of listening to canned music and repeated "stay on the line" messages, I gave up and decided to drive over to the store while my wife stayed on the line. Now nearly 2 1/2 hours after placing my order, the attitude at the storefront was clear - we neither are about your business nor do we have any idea what we are doing. First, they couldn't find my order. Once they found it, they couldn't figure out where my pizzas were. Were they in a hotbox? Out for delivery? Still unmade? They had no idea. Even worse, they made it clear that they felt it was unreasonable that I was even asking. "We are slammed" and "we only have 2 delivery drivers" was the response. I get that - it happens. But... a simple apology rather than excuses might be a better solution. Not once did the store workers give anything but excuses and they left a clear impression that they just didn't care. I mentioned that we'd been on the phone for 30 minutes to try to get an answer. "Oh, the phones were crazy so we turned them off" was the response. Off but left the "hold on the line" message running. If that doesn't tell you everything you need to know about Dough Boys, I don't know what would. Eventually, our pizzas were delivered. To no one's surprise, they were cold. And, as you can see in the picture, the toppings had slid off of half of the pizza long before. To top it all off, one of our pizzas was wrong. A cheese pizza for a person with allergies was loaded with toppings. However, since we now knew that the store had turned their phones off, there was no way to call and complain or ask for a refund. Convenient for them, I suppose, but the perfect ending to a miserable experience. There are too many other pizza options on the Island to risk having an experience like this. Pick another option.

The garlic knots was hard. Perhaps over baked or old/reheated. The chicken wings tasted old / reheated, and the pizza was not flavorful. The dough for the gluten free bread was average, most gluten free pizzas have hard crust, no real problem there. But the crust to the non gluten free pizza was dry too! I was visiting the area and according to the reviews, most people recommend this place. I guess it's people who live here and are used to eating their pizza that way. Overall it was not horrible, but the price did not match the quality of the pizza and eating out has become understandably expensive so you want your money to be spent with good use. No complaints about the service. The place appeared take out only. It's located in a strip mall / shopping center. Best of luck if you try this place out.

We popped in an ordered a Big Caruna pizza (half pepperoni and half sausage with onion, ricotta and red pepper flakes). We decided to eat at one of the picnic tables outside in front. A friendly server brought us water and silverware. Our pizza came out pretty quick-maybe 10 minutes-and the 12" was the perfect size for the two of us. I had a bit of a preference for the sausage side but both sides were good. The thin crust had a faint tanginess adding some extra flavor. As we were only drinking water, the meal was under $20-a great value too
